11 Memorable Moments From Breaking Bad Season 2

With a 97% approval rating on Rotten Tomatoes review aggregator, season 2 of Breaking Bad had us shook and hooked and deeply involved in the story of “how to get away with making meth and selling it for a huge profit when you’re a dying old man and your partner is a loser drug addict”. Supporting characters didn’t disappoint with their inputs of drama either.

Skyler’s iconic rant and Hank’s priceless expression

When Hank visits Skyler to convince her to return Marie’s calls, she reveals to him that Marie is a shoplifter. Hank said she’s in therapy for her kleptomania and they should be supportive of Marie. Skyler explodes:

I need support. Me – the almost 40-year old pregnant woman with the surprise baby on the way and the husband with the lung cancer, who disappears for hours on end and I don’t know where he goes and he barely even speaks to me anymore… with the moody son who does the same thing… and the overdrawn checking account… and the lukewarm water heater that leaks rusty-looking crap… and is rotting out the floor of the utility closet and we can’t even afford to fix it… But OWWWHH! I see! Now, I’m supposed to go – Hank, please, what can I possibly do to further benefit my spoiled, kleptomaniac bitch sister who somehow always manages to be the centre of attention… coz god knows, SHE’S THE ONE, WITH THE REALLY IMPORTANT PROBLEMS….!!!!

Hector tries to save Tuco

When Heisenberg and Jesse poison Tuco’s food as he kidnaps them to take them to Mexico, the ever insidious Hector Salamanca, who can’t speak and is in a wheelchair, saves Tuco’s life using his little bell and knocking over his poisoned food, and getting Tuco to doubt Heisenberg and Jesse. One for the cartel, you’d think. But immediately after that Walter and Jesse manage to shoot Tuco and escape.

Naked Walter at the supermarket

Yet another iconic moment from the show when Walter decides to roam a supermarket naked, pretending to be in a fugue state so that he doesn’t have to explain his disappearance to Skyler and Hank and the fact that he and Jesse were kidnapped by Tuco Salamanca.

Hector and his bodily fluids

Back at the precinct where Jesse is being questioned by Hank for his involvement in Tuco’s death, Hector is called in to identify Jesse as the man who was in their house conducting business with Tuco.

Hector, instead of identifying Jesse, looks at Hank and lets one rip while defecating freely in his wheelchair…. Don’t know what to make of it, but it sure is grotesque and shocking.

Jesse steals his own RV

Jesse leaves his cook RV with Badger’s cousin to hide it from the DEA. After Jesse’s kicked out of his home and has nowhere to go and is down and out, he breaks into the scrapyard and spends the night in the RV. Next morning when Badger’s cousin asks for money and threatens to sell his lab equipment, Jesse leaves… only to sneak back in, break the RV out, break the gate, and drive away like a thug. 

Jesse plays Peekaboo

When two junkies swindle Jesse’s dealer Skinny Pete, Heisenberg gets Jesse to track them down and recover their money and meth. At their pigsty of a home, he finds their little boy, unbathed, unfed and neglected. He feeds him and plays Peekaboo with him. After the stolen ATM machine falls on the face of the junkie dad and kills him, Jesse takes the money from it and runs. But before that, he takes care of the kid, wraps him in a blanket and leaves him outside on the porch so he doesn’t have to see his dead dad and can be found by the authorities. Jesse’s finest moment.

Tortuga in the desert

The severed head of El Paso DEA team’s informant Tortuga (Danny Trejo) mounted on a real live tortoise, left to roam around in the desert. Ghastly! Oh and the head explodes too, killing and decapitating DEA agents. Deadly!

Walter makes a battery

One more for science. When Walter and Jesse are out cooking in the RV, the battery dies. Walter, after being depressed for one straight day and coughing blood, makes a new battery out of coins, copper wire and sponges. The science is beyond Jesse but the scene continues to remain epic till today.

Heisenberg marks his territory

When Walter is at the hardware supply market, he sees a wannabe meth cook’s shopping cart and proceeds to instruct him on how to shop for the right materials. The guy gets scared and runs off. Then a switch is flipped in Walter’s head. He goes to the parking lot, all gangsta-like, finds the same guy and his partner near their van, walks up to him, stares him down Heisenberg-style and says – “STAY OFF MY TERRITORY”. 

Saul Goodman shows tough love

The irreverent “criminal” lawyer is a voice of reason when one of Jesse’s drug dealers Combo is shot in a new territory. Saul tells a visibly upset Jesse that these things are known to happen and tells Walter and Jesse straight up they ‘suck at peddling meth’. Being generous and shrewd and all, for a sizable cut, he offers to hook them up with the region’s kingpin, through a guy who knows a guy, who knows a guy, who knows a guy. 

Gustavo Fring enters the chat

Los Pollos Hermanos, the iconic fast food chain, a staple of Breaking Bad and Better Call Saul, makes an entrance in the second season, as does Gus. A perfectly polite and hardworking owner of the restaurant chain, an upstanding citizen of Albuquerque (and a secretly petrifying drug lord) Gus is managerial when he meets Walter and refuses to work with him as he sees that Jesse is late for the meeting and shows up high. He tells Walter as their meeting concludes, ‘never trust a drug addict’.
